Posts - Bill - S 2008 Stop Funding Genital Mutilation Act
senate 06/10/2025 - 119th Congress
We are working to ensure that federal Medicaid and CHIP funds are not used to cover gender transition procedures, aiming to restrict these specific medical treatments from public healthcare programs.
